Jeremy is an English equivalent of the Italian name Geremio, which is a variant of Geremia.
Specifically, the Italian and English names are masculine proper nouns. They trace their origins back to the ancient Hebrew name יִרְמְיָהוּ (YirmayÄhÅ«). Its original meaning is "Yahweh exalts" (Esaltazione del Signore).
The pronunciation is "djeh-reh-MEE-oh."

Traduzione dall'italiano all'inglese is an Italian equivalent of the English phrase "Italian to English translation." The prepositional phrase translates literally into English as "translation from the Italian to the English." The pronunciation will be "TRA-doo-TSYO-ney dal-LEE-ta-LYA-no al-leen-GLEY-zey" in Italian.
